Borderlands 4 Cryo Whip Amon Build
A complete Cryo Whip Amon build for Borderlands 4. Uses Scourge action skill with Eternal Winter augment for permanent whip uptime, Blue tree for Cryo Ordnance power, and Red tree for Berserk damage multipliers. Designed for mob clearing and boss melting with whip spam.
Core Mechanics: How the Build Works
The Cryo Whip Amon build centers on the Scourge action skill with the Eternal Winter augment. This gives cryo forge waves and whips that deal heavy Ordnance damage and apply Cryo status. Eternal Winter extends the skill duration massively and boosts damage, keeping whips active nearly permanently.
The gameplay loop is simple: keep whips active, spam them on enemies for Cryo application and damage reduction, shoot to proc stacking DoTs, and maintain Berserk stacks for bonus Cryo damage. The result is a tanky, high-DPS playstyle that excels at both mob clearing and boss melting.
Eternal Winter keeps Scourge active almost permanently. Combined with Tail of the Comet (stacking Cryo DoT) and Berserk multipliers from the Red tree, you get hundreds of percent bonus Cryo damage at high stacks. Face enemies for damage reduction while whipping for both offense and defense.
Skill Tree Priorities
Blue Tree (Core Cryo and Whip Power)
- Scourge + Eternal Winter augment - The foundation. Permanent whip uptime and boosted damage.
- Scorches Kairos, Tail of the Comet - Big stacking Cryo DoT on hits. Core for ramping damage over time.
- Ancient Ways - Passive damage bonuses.
- Cryonic Thrum - Bonus Cryo gun damage while skill is active.
- Gut Punch / Primal Surge - More procs and ammo sustain.
- Blackout - 1+ points for crit bonuses.
- Glacial Rapture (capstone) - Extra cryo hazard zones and crowd control.
Red Tree (Damage and Berserk)
- Discombobulate, Wield the Storm - Damage amplification nodes.
- Gut Punch, Tritanium Knuckles - Melee and proc synergy.
- Berserk + There is Only Red - Stack for massive bonus Cryo damage, up to hundreds of percent at high stacks. Refresh via kills and whips.
- The Best Defense - 1 point for survivability.
- Brimming Vigor, My Touch is Death - Sustain and damage nodes.

Gear Recommendations
- Weapons: Spread-shot Balor or Dullahan shotgun for bossing, Jacobs Kickballer, Discs Stellium, Katagawa's Revenge sniper, Plasma Coil, Sweet Embrace. Cryo weapons amplify the build's bonuses.
- Firmware: 3-piece Reel Big Fist + 2-piece GOOJFC for buff combinations.
- Shield: Watts 4 Dinner (with Evasive), Triple Bypass.
- Class Mod: Shatterwight (bonus to Berserk or whip skills). Look for +Tail of the Comet or Cryo/Ordnance perks.
- Enhancements: Any Gun Damage enhancement to buff whip damage. Penetrator Augment Throwing Knife optional.
Rotation and Playstyle
-
Activate Scourge and Keep It Up
Pop Scourge to bring out whips. Spam forge waves and whips on groups and bosses for Cryo application and damage reduction. Eternal Winter keeps the skill active nearly permanently, but refresh as needed.
-
Shoot to Proc DoTs and Stack Berserk
While whips are active, shoot enemies to proc Tail of the Comet Cryo DoTs. Each hit stacks more damage. Kills refresh Berserk stacks for bonus Cryo damage multiplier.
-
Maintain Whip Spam for Uptime
Use whips constantly to refresh durations, detonate effects, and maintain uptime. Throw knife or use forgeskill as needed for additional procs. Position to face enemies for damage reduction while whipping.
-
Recover Skills if Dropped
If Scourge drops, use specializations like Now with Caffeine for quick skill recovery. Get whips back up immediately, you are fragile without them.
Key Decision Points
Blue-Heavy vs. Hybrid
Pure Blue maximizes whip and Ordnance uptime with easy tankiness. Hybrid (Blue + Red) adds Berserk multipliers for higher burst. Start Blue, add Red points once you have good gear.
Ordnance Choice
Heavy launchers or homing guns (like Aitling Gun) for reliable procs. Tail of the Comet loves fast-firing or high-damage shots to stack DoTs quickly.
Class Mod Selection
Shatterwight is frequently praised for bonus to Berserk or whip skills. Look for +Tail of the Comet or Cryo/Ordnance perks to match your tree investment.
Melee vs. Gun Focus
Whips handle mob clearing and Cryo application. Guns proc DoT stacks and Berserk. Balance both, do not neglect shooting while whips are active.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Ignoring action skill uptime. Without Scourge active, you lose both damage and damage reduction. Prioritize Eternal Winter and refresh skills immediately if they drop.
- Spreading points too thin across all trees. Blue and Red focus is stronger for this archetype. Green tree investments dilute your core power.
- Using slow ordnance without procs. Tail of the Comet and Gut Punch need decent fire rate and status application to stack effectively.
- Neglecting Cryo synergies or Berserk stacking. These are the big damage multipliers that make the build scale. Always maintain stacks during combat.
